Hi, Frogger! :)

I'm no authority on this subject, but you may have difficulty for this scholarship due to the eligibility criteria. Applicants must:

1. Be aged 30 years old or less in the selection year.
2. Have a single nationality from a developing country deemed an "emerging country" by the French state department, especially those in Asia and Latin America, for example, currently under-represented among the student population in France.


The scholarship is sponsored by the French government (French ministry of Foreign Affairs), but I think that you apply through HEC. In other words, HEC acts as a filter or middleman in the process. That was my impression, at least.

I'm sure that you have already seen this, but here is a brief description of it just in case. If you still have any questions, contact the HEC admissions department.

hi prasetogosho

for applying a loan to BNP, you need either a french guarantee(french citizen living in france, citizen living abroad but property in france) or a guarantee from a local bank(bank in your country). the interest rate is 3.2% but getting a guarantee from a local bank seems to be a really difficult step. for eg in india only very few nationalised banks give this kind of guarantee and most insist you should have an account with them which is more than 6 months old.

levfin2003
Curious to know whats HEC's January intake like? Is the class evenly divided between Jan and September?

The Jan intake is much much smaller than September. Think ~60 students vs. ~160 in September. It's not like INSEAD's setup. Also, the Jan intake has a slightly different calendar. They go through all the same phases but the way it falls on the calendar, their internship time is about the same time they would start a new job. There are other differences as well I believe but I didn't do a good job of researching them.
